Verb / UK Slang
Blag refers to the act of obtaining something through deceit or persuasion, often without rightful entitlement. It can also mean to get something through cunning or to trick someone.
Example: “He managed to blag his way into the exclusive party.”
Means: “He tricked or persuaded his way into the exclusive party.”
Example: “I’m going to try to blag a free drink from the bartender.”
Means: “I’m going to try to get a free drink by persuading or tricking the bartender.”
